Latest Patents

Bressickello's latest patents include the "Water Heater with Submerged Combustion Chamber" and the "Gas Supplemented Solar Collector Storage Means." The water heater features a totally submerged combustion chamber located within the lower third of the tank, ensuring efficient heat exchange through an upwardly extending flue pipe and an inlet side cylinder. This design allows for a gas burner to be operated by a thermostat, guaranteeing a continuous supply of hot water.

The second patent, the gas supplemented solar collector storage means, incorporates a water tank with supply and return connections for circulating water between the tank and a solar collector. Within the upper half of the tank, a combustion chamber is designed with top and side openings, similarly allowing for effective air and gas passage in heat exchange with water. Here, the gas burner is also operated by a thermostat, supplying heat when solar heating proves insufficient.

Career Highlights

Currently, Bressickello is associated with Mor-Flo Industries, Inc., where she contributes her innovative expertise to the development of advanced water heating solutions. Her work reflects a deep understanding of the mechanics involved in heating systems, paving the way for improved efficiency and sustainability in water heating technologies.
